Formal Language Theory

Definition

In the context of alphabets, strings, and languages, difference refers to the distinct characteristics that separate elements within a set or a collection. It plays a crucial role in defining how various strings can be derived from a given alphabet and helps in understanding the variations among different languages constructed from those strings.

Review Questions

  • How does the concept of difference help in distinguishing between different strings derived from the same alphabet?
    • The concept of difference is crucial for distinguishing between strings since it highlights that even the slightest change in characters results in entirely different strings. For instance, if one string is 'abc' and another is 'abx', the difference lies in the last character. This principle helps establish clear criteria for uniqueness among strings, reinforcing the notion that strings are defined not just by their length but also by their individual symbols.
